Downtown Bremerton is Opening Soon

We are excited to share that the refreshed Downtown Bremerton branch will reopen to the public on Monday, December 11.

Closing on July 17, Kitsap Regional Library has been working collaboratively with the building owner, the City of Bremerton, as they completed essential upgrades to the Downtown Bremerton branch.

The primary focus of this project has been the installation of a much-needed heating, ventilation, and air conditioning (HVAC) system, addressing the challenge of maintaining a comfortable environment for library visitors. The unique construction of this historic building presented significant challenges, but the City’s dedication to this project has been unwavering.

While the building was temporarily closed for these critical HVAC improvements, the Library took the opportunity to enhance the facility further. This included a comprehensive upgrade of the network cabling to support the growing demand for technology within the library. Additionally, we anticipate the reopening will bring a fresh look with new signage.

Previous to this closure, this branch has had a history of unscheduled closures in extreme weather due to the lack of heating and cooling support in the building. As we approach the winter months, we eagerly anticipate the reopening of the Downtown Bremerton branch.

Our libraries play a critical role in their communities by providing shelter as warming and cooling centers in extreme weather. Now, our Downtown Bremerton branch can also serve our community in this way.
